The Nigeria Security and Civil Defence Corps (NSCDC), Sokoto State Command, has extended warm greetings to Muslim faithful as the holy month of Ramadan begins, urging prayers for peace, unity and national development.
In a message released on Wednesday, the State Commandant, CC E.A. Ajayi, congratulated Muslims in Sokoto State and across the country on the commencement of the sacred month. He described Ramadan as a period of compassion, reflection and renewed commitment to service and humanity.
The Commandant also conveyed special goodwill to the Commandant General of the Corps, Ahmed Abubakar Audi, as well as the Zonal Commander, Zone 10, ACG Bello Alkali Argungu, for their leadership and support to the Sokoto State Command. He further appreciated members of the management staff for their dedication to duty.
Ajayi, speaking on behalf of the management and personnel of the Command, prayed for good health, prosperity and spiritual fulfillment for all Muslims observing the fast. He noted that Ramadan offers an opportunity to strengthen faith, promote discipline and reinforce the values of sacrifice and tolerance.
He expressed hope that the holy month would usher in peace and tranquillity for Nigeria and the Muslim faithful worldwide, praying that Allah grants mercy, favour and guidance throughout the period.
